TEMPO.CO, Jakarta - The Indonesian Embassy in Moscow, Russia, held a cultural event called "Indonesian Night: Happy Breaking the Fast" in their annual event "Tenda Ramadhan 2024" or the "2024 Ramadan Tent" which was held by the Indonesian Embassy in Moscow together with the Moscow City Muslim Spiritual Agency (BSMM), in the courtyard of the Moscow Memorial Mosque, on Thursday, March 28, 2024, according to a press release received by Tempo on Tuesday, April 02, 2024.

A fourth year Indonesian student majoring in aircraft engineering at Moscow Aviation Institute, Muhammad Reza Syah Pahlevi, did the evening call to prayer in a Javanese style, marking the iftar for hundreds of visitors to the cultural event.

The "2024 Ramadan Tent" event was opened by the Chairman of BSMM, Mufti Ildar-hazrat Alyautdinov, who appreciated the participation of the Indonesian Embassy in Moscow in holding this event. He also hoped that Indonesia will continue to participate in the following years, in order to further strengthen the ties of friendship and cooperation between the people of the two countries.

The Imam of the Moscow Memorial Mosque, Damirzhan Zainutdinov, also delivered a sermon about the benefits of fasting for health.

The Ambassador of the Republic of Indonesia to the Russian Federation, who also serves to the Republic of Belarus as well, Jose Antonio Morato Tavares, in his speech expressed his condolences regarding the terrorist act at Crocus City Hall Moscow, on March 22, 2024 and briefly explained the meaning of the theme of the Ramadan Tent event held by Indonesia.

The annual event "Tenda Ramadhan" has been held by BSMM since 2006 and is the only iftar activity in Russia which invites participation in arts and culture performances by foreign diplomatic representatives or community organizations, while in many mosques or other cultural centers in Russia, activities in the month of Ramadan are iftar only, which is preceded by a tausyiah (sermon) as is generally the case in Indonesia.

At this year's Ramadan Tent, the event was attended by representatives of the embassies of Saudi Arabia, Turkey, Kyrgystan, Kazakhstan, Qatar, Uzbekistan, Turkmenistan, Azerbaijan, Tajikistan, Iran, Afghanistan, various federal subjects and mass organizations in Russia.
